Summary
Chronic alcohol abuse can cause seizures, even with midline cerebellar degeneration. This specific brain damage in alcoholics doesn't increase seizure risk compared to the general alcoholic population.

Background:
- Chronic alcoholism is associated with various neurological complications.
- Midline cerebellar degeneration is a known consequence of long-term alcohol abuse.
- Alcohol-related seizures are a significant clinical concern in alcoholic patients.
Purpose of the Study:
- To investigate the relationship between midline cerebellar degeneration and the occurrence of alcohol-related seizures.
- To determine if cerebellar degeneration specifically influences seizure incidence in chronic alcoholics.
Main Methods:
- Evaluation of 48 chronic alcoholic patients presenting with clinical signs of midline cerebellar disease.
- Assessment of seizure history and incidence within this patient cohort.
- Comparison of seizure incidence with data from severely alcoholic hospitalized populations.
Main Results:
- Approximately 15% of the evaluated chronic alcoholic patients experienced alcohol-related seizures.
- The observed seizure incidence in patients with midline cerebellar degeneration was comparable to that in the broader severely alcoholic hospitalized group.
- No statistically significant difference in seizure diathesis was found between patients with and without evident cerebellar degeneration.
Conclusions:
- Midline cerebellar degeneration, a consequence of chronic alcoholism, does not appear to independently increase the risk or incidence of seizures.
- Seizure risk in chronic alcoholics is likely influenced by factors other than specific cerebellar degeneration.
